15,513,216 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.
15513216 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of sixty-four divisors.
Prime factorization of 15513216:
27 × 3 × 71 × 569

Factors of 15513216
Divisors of 15513216
- Number of divisors d(n): 64
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 2 3 4 6 8 12 16 24 32 48 64 71 96 128 142 192 213 284 384 426 568 569 852 1136 1138 1704 1707 2272 2276 3408 3414 4544 4552 6816 6828 9088 9104 13632 13656 18208 27264 27312 36416 40399 54624 72832 80798 109248 121197 161596 218496 242394 323192 484788 646384 969576 1292768 1939152 2585536 3878304 5171072 7756608 15513216
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 41860800
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 26347584
- 15513216 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(26347584)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 10834368
